LinMeng LinMeng
4年前
ES6之set
constsnewSet();2,3,4,2,3,4,5,6,2,3,3.forEach(xs.add(x))console.log(s);for(letiofs){console.log(i)}console.log(s.add(9));//add(value),添加某个值,返回Set结构本身console.log(s.d
Wesley13 Wesley13
3年前
java 开发过程,各种各样的注解
@RetentionRetention(保留)注解说明,这种类型的注解会被保留到那个阶段. 有三个值:1.RetentionPolicy.SOURCE —— 这种类型的Annotations只在源代码级别保留,编译时就会被忽略2.RetentionPolicy.CLASS —— 这种类型的Annota
Wesley13 Wesley13
3年前
JAVA拦截器,JAVA返回结果跨域问题解决
遇到的问题:通过拦截器做权限控制,没有权限时返回了json值,结果前端请求时提示跨域了备注:我的前端站点和后端站点不是一个地址报错1:AccesstoXMLHttpRequestat'http://localhost:8089/appcicd/appinfo/getappinfos'fromorigi
Stella981 Stella981
3年前
DataGear 自定义数据可视化看板的图表主题
DataGear(https://www.oschina.net/action/GoToLink?urlhttp%3A%2F%2Fdatagear.tech%2F)看板的dgcharttheme属性,提供了简单且强大的自定义图表主题功能。通常,只需要设置其color、backgroundColor、actualBackgroundColor值即
Wesley13 Wesley13
3年前
MySQL创建表时加入的约束以及外键约束的的意义
1,创建表时加入的约束a) 非空约束,notnullb) 唯一约束,uniquec) 主键约束,primarykeyd) 外键约束,foreignkey1,非空约束,针对某个字段设置其值不为空,如:学生的姓名不能为空droptableifexistst_studen
Stella981 Stella981
3年前
Android 四种特殊Interpolator源码解析
源博客链接:http://linkyan.com/2013/06/animationinterpolator/(https://www.oschina.net/action/GoToLink?urlhttp%3A%2F%2Flinkyan.com%2F2013%2F06%2Fanimationinterpolator%2F)今天介绍4种动画插值
Stella981 Stella981
3年前
NDK OpenGLES3.0 开发(十一):模板测试
!(https://oscimg.oschina.net/oscnet/c0b948092f5ded8fbfe2ab809ff4cce762d.gif)OpenGLES模板测试模板测试与深度测试类似,主要作用是利用模板缓冲区(StencilBuffer)所保存的模板值决定
Stella981 Stella981
3年前
JVM垃圾回收器GC的常用参数
GC常用参数年轻代最小堆最大堆栈空间XmnXmsXmxXssSystem.gc()不管用,避免因System.gc()调用导致的FGC,生产环境建议XX:DisableExplicitGC年轻代存活对象升代年龄,最大值15(CMS默认是6,Par
Wesley13 Wesley13
3年前
MYsql客户端图形化工具第一天
客户端图形化工具:SQLyog   DML:增删改表中数据(重点)    1.添加数据   \语法:      \insertinto表名(列名1,列名2,,,,列名n)   values(表1,表2,,表n);         \注意:            1.列名和值一一对应 
Stella981 Stella981
3年前
Mybatis之BatchExecutor.doUpdate返回Integer.MIN_VALUE + 1002
  Mybatis版本是3.4.4  之前没注意,但是一个偶然机会发现BatchExecutor.doUpdate方法返回一个固定值Integer.MIN\_VALUE1002,即源码中的org.apache.ibatis.executor.BatchExecutorBATCH\_UPDATE\_RETURN\_VALUE,为什么返回这个